What Changed
- ▶
Approved Indications: BEFORE, Durvalumab was approved in India primarily for non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C) and biliary tract cancer. NOW, the CDSCO has officially expanded its approved indication to include limited-stage small cell lung cancer (LS-SCLC).
- ▶
Post-Chemoradiation Care: BEFORE, patients with LS-SCLC had very few targeted maintenance therapies available after completing initial platinum-based chemoradiation. NOW, Durvalumab is specifically approved as a follow-up immunotherapy for patients whose disease has not progressed following this initial treatment.
- ▶
Distribution Authorization: BEFORE, AstraZeneca could not officially market Imfinzi for small cell lung cancer in India without special off-label exemptions. NOW, the company has formal regulatory clearance to directly import, sell, and distribute the specific infusion doses for this exact demographic.
